Vice President to Lead Discussions on Technology-Enabled Legal Services

Vice President C.P. Radhakrishnan will be heading discussions on enhancing access to justice through technology-based legal services at a National Consultation scheduled for Sunday. The Department of Justice, Ministry of Law and Justice, is hosting this event to facilitate discussions, policy dialogues, and engagement with stakeholders. The consultation is part of the Tele-Law initiative under the Designing Innovative Solutions for Holistic Access to Justice (DISHA) Scheme.

Minister of State (Independent Charge) for Law and Justice Arjun Ram Meghwal will also be actively involved in the consultation, which is a continuation of the Department’s ongoing initiatives. The event will include the unveiling of the “Voice of Beneficiaries” Booklet 2025–26, showcasing impactful stories of individuals benefiting from Tele-Law services, highlighting the positive impact of digital access to justice.

The consultation will feature a detailed overview of the progress of the DISHA Scheme nationwide, with live interactions involving Tele-Law Panel Lawyers, Village Level Entrepreneurs (VLEs), and beneficiaries, demonstrating the practical effects of technology-driven legal assistance. Additionally, there will be a special segment commemorating 150 years of the National Song “Vande Mataram”, performed by local artists, emphasizing its historical and cultural significance.
